氟康唑诱发的症状性苯妥英中毒。

Fluconazole-induced symptomatic phenytoin toxicity.

作者信息

Cadle R M, Zenon G J, Rodriguez-Barradas M C, Hamill R J

机构信息

Department of Veterans Affairs Medical Center (VAMC), Pharmacy Service, Houston, TX 77030.

出版信息

Ann Pharmacother. 1994 Feb;28(2):191-5. doi: 10.1177/106002809402800206.

DOI:10.1177/106002809402800206
PMID:8173131
Abstract

OBJECTIVE

To report two cases of fluconazole-induced symptomatic phenytoin toxicity and review literature related to this interaction.

DATA SOURCES

Case reports and review articles identified by a computerized (MEDLINE) and manual (Index Medicus) search.

DATA SYNTHESIS

Fluconazole is a broad-spectrum triazole antifungal agent primarily eliminated by renal mechanisms, although hepatic cytochrome P-450 inhibition and hepatotoxicity have been observed. We report two cases of fluconazole-induced symptomatic phenytoin toxicity. Both patients received high doses of the drug; one patient developed phenytoin toxicity only after long-term coadministration. Previously reported cases have occurred primarily with high-dose fluconazole and short-term coadministration.

CONCLUSIONS

Fluconazole can increase phenytoin serum concentrations leading to toxicity. Constant and continuous monitoring of serum phenytoin concentrations with fluconazole doses as low as 200 mg/d is warranted.

摘要

目的

报告两例氟康唑诱发的有症状的苯妥英钠中毒病例,并回顾与此相互作用相关的文献。

资料来源

通过计算机检索(MEDLINE)和手工检索(医学索引)确定的病例报告和综述文章。

资料综合

氟康唑是一种广谱三唑类抗真菌药,主要通过肾脏机制消除,尽管已观察到其对肝细胞色素P-450的抑制作用和肝毒性。我们报告两例氟康唑诱发的有症状的苯妥英钠中毒病例。两名患者均接受了高剂量该药治疗;一名患者仅在长期联合用药后才出现苯妥英钠中毒。先前报道的病例主要发生在高剂量氟康唑和短期联合用药的情况下。

结论

氟康唑可使苯妥英钠血清浓度升高,导致中毒。即使氟康唑剂量低至200mg/d,也有必要持续不断地监测血清苯妥英钠浓度。
